Domino 9 und frühere Versionen > ND8: Entwicklung

Richtextfeld kopieren und Attachments rauslöschen

(1/2) > >>

Legolas:
Hallo Forum,

ich sehe wohl gerade den Wald vor lauter Bäumen nicht mehr.
Ist das überhaupt möglich was ich tun will?

Ich will ein Richtextfeld, welches Attachments beinhaltet, kopieren und im neuen RT-Feld alle Attachments rauslöschen.
Das neue RT-Feld soll danach aussehen, als ob nie ein Attachment in diesem Feld gewesen wäre!

Am liebsten wäre es mir, wenn dies innerhalb des gleichen Dokuments beim Speichern geschehen könnte.


Grüße
Bernd

DerAndre:
Hi Bernd.

Meinst Du

notesrichtextitem.GetUnformattedText

oder

notesrichtextitem.GetFormattedText

Legolas:
Hallo DerAndre,

leider hilft mir diese Funktion nicht weiter, da die gesamte Formatierung des RT-Feldes verloren geht!

Der Inhalt des original RT-Feld mit all seinen Formatierunge (Schriftart, Grafik, usw.) soll im neuen RT-Feld bestehen bleiben.
Lediglich alle Attachemnts sollen aus dem neuen RT-Feld verschwunden sein, als ob diese nie da gewesen wären.

Grüße
Bernd

Axel:
Schau dir mal die Methoden

notesItem.CopyItemToDocument( document, newName$ )

notesEmbeddedObject.Remove

in der Designer-Hilfe an. Da gibt's auch Beispiele dazu. Vielleicht bringt dich das weiter.

Axel

Driri:
Ich mag mich irren, aber gab es da nicht Probleme, wenn man innerhalb eines Dokumentes das RichText-Item quasi verdoppelt ? Irgendwas habe ich da im Hinterkopf, daß dann die verdoppelten Attachments kryptischen Dateinamen bekamen oder so was. Das sollte man also auf jeden Fall gut testen.

Navigation

[0] Themen-Index

[#] Nächste Seite

Zur normalen Ansicht wechseln